How long does a PA UC appeal take?

Depending upon the type of case, the facts involved, and the research required, Referee decisions are usually issued within 30 – 45 days after the appeal was filed. Board decisions are usually issued within 45 – 75 days after the further appeal was filed.

How do I appeal unemployment denial in PA?

If your claim for benefits is denied, you have 15 days from the mailing date on the determination to file an appeal. You can file your appeal online, by mail, by fax, or in person at a PA Career Link location. No matter how you file, you must file your appeal with the service center listed on the determination letter.

Do you have to pay back unemployment If you lose an appeal PA?

In PA, if the eligibility determination granting you UC benefits is reversed, you will have to repay the benefits you received only if you were paid benefits through your own fault.Mar 3, 2011

What is attorney fee agreement?

An attorney fee agreement is a contract between you and your lawyer. As when entering any contract, you can and should consider negotiating the terms. Ask the lawyer to tell you all of the fee alternatives that he or she would consider for the services that you are contemplating. Then you can make a proposal and try to get the best arrangement.

What happens if you win a case?

If you win your case, any penalties and attorneys' fees awarded by the court would be added to your total award. The lawyer's percentage would then be taken out of the total award. In other words, the lawyer's cut may amount to more than the attorneys' fees awarded by the court.

What is contingent fee?

A contingent fee is an agreed percentage (usually ranging from one-third to 40%) of the total amount recovered in the action, whether awarded in court or through a settlement. This arrangement means that you won't pay the lawyer any fees unless your lawyer recovers some money on your behalf. However, your lawyer might ask for a retainer fee in addition to the contingent fee, in order to guarantee him or her some fees in the event that you lose your case. The amount of the retainer is agreed upon between you and your lawyer.

What to do if unemployment is denied?

If your unemployment claim is denied, you have the right to appeal. State procedures differ, but typically you will have to file a written appeal and attend a hearing, in person or by phone, to state why you think you are entitled to benefits.

What to do if your employer violates your rights?

If you believe your employer has violated your legal rights, you should consult with a lawyer to find out how strong your claims are. For example, you might believe that you were selected for layoff because of your race, or that your employer fired you in retaliation for reporting health and safety violations.
